본문 바로가기

01_Overview/Course_Introduction

Arm MBED-달리웍스 씽플러스 워크숍 안내




플랫폼 연계 IoT 서비스 개발 워크숍 2차 Arm Mbed 참가 개발자를 모집합니다. 사물인터넷 기기 개발을 위한 고급과정으로, 10월 3일 까지 모집합니다. 많은 참가 신청 바랍니다.  


(참가신청 : https://mybiz.sba.kr/Pages/BusinessApply/PostingDetail.aspx?p=1&mid=9ed1711a-deba-e811-80d6-9418827691e3 )



 - 개발 환경구축 : https://os.mbed.com/docs/latest/tools/installing-with-the-windows-installer.html

 - 온라인 강의 : http://www.seoulhackathon.org/category/Video_Tutorial/arm_MBED_OS_Cloud

                     http://www.seoulhackathon.org/category/Video_Tutorial/Daliworks_ThingPlus 


[Arm Mbed Cloud] 보드 제어, 디바이스 관리

 (Mbed 및 Mbed Cloud) 상용 IoT 개발을 위한 우수한 조건을 보유한 플랫폼

     · 글로벌 20만명 이상 개발자 보유(2016년말 기준)로 다양한 개발사례 존재 

     · 해당 보드관련 소스코드 공개로 상대적으로 쉬운 개발가능 

     · 100개 이상의 사용가능 상용보드 보유하고 있으며, 다양한 양산에 적합한 다양한 가격대의 보드를 보유하고 있음

     

(Arm Mbed 최근 동향) Arm Mbed는 최근 한전과 개방형 AMI 과제 협력 계약을 체결함

[Daliworks Thingplus] 서비스 구성 및 운영     국내 서비스 IoT 클라우드 플랫폼

- Thng+는 유럽, 일본,동남아, 미국, 남미 등에서 서비스 하고 있는 상용 IoT 플랫폼.

- 글로벌 5000명 이상의 개발자가 사용하고 있음(전체 사용자 9000명)

- thingplus 서버로 직접 연결하는 direct 방식과 mbed-cloud, lora 서버등의 서버와 연동되는 in-direct 방식을 모두 지원함.

- 최근은 LoRaWan 장비를 이용한 smart farm, smart building, smart factory가 많이 서비스 되고 있으며, edge컴퓨팅을 활용한 EMS에 주력하고 있음.



[ 교육과정의 전체 시스템 구성 ]



가. 워크숍 개요

  □ 워크숍 일자 : ‘18.10.5(금)~ ‘18.10.12(금)

  □ 워크숍 시간 : 09:30 ~ 17:30 (1일 7시간) ※ 중식 제공

  □ 워크숍 장소 : 서울IoT센터 [서울시 구로구 디지털로 26길 72]

  □ 워크숍 목적

   - (개발 역량) Mbed Cloud를 활용한 IoT기기 개발역량 습득

   - (핵심 네트워크 구축) Mbed Cloud를 활용한 IoT기기 개발자간 협조 핵심네트워크 구축

  □ 실습키트 구성

   - 개발보드 + 센서키트 (교육기간중 실습키트 제공)


- NUCLEO-F429ZI 보드

  

 ·STM32 microcontroller in LQFP144 package

 ·External SMPS to generate Vcore logic supply (only available on '-P' suffixed boards)

 ·Ethernet compliant with IEEE-802.3-2002 (depending on STM32 support)

 ·USB OTG or full-speed device (depending on STM32 support)

 ·3 user LEDs

 ·2 user and reset push-buttons

 ·32.768 kHz crystal oscillator

 ·Board connectors: USB with Micro-AB, SWD, Ethernet RJ45 (depending on STM32 support), ST Zio connector including Arduino™ Uno V3, ST morpho

 ·Flexible power-supply options: ST-LINK USB VBUS or external sources

 ·Support of a wide choice of Integrated Development Environments (IDEs) including IAR™, Keil® , GCC-based IDEs, Arm® Mbed™

 ·Arm® Mbed Enabled™ compliant (only for some Nucleo part numbers)


- WizFi310 Wifi

 ·Single band 2.4GHz IEEE 802.11b/g/n

 ·72.2Mbps receive PHY rate and 72.2Mbps transmit PHY rate using 20MHz bandwidth

 ·150Mbps receive PHY rate and 150Mbps transmit PHY rate using 40MHz bandwidth

 ·Low power consumption & excellent power management performance extend battery life

 ·Easy for integration into mobile and handheld device with flexible system configuration

 ·Serial Interface : UART

 ·UART Max Baud : 921600 bps

 ·Soft AP : Enough memory retention, Wi-Fi Security (WEP, WPA/WPA2PSK), L2 Switching

 ·OTA(Over The Air F/W Upgrading)


- 아두이노 종결키트 (입문자용) (Arduino Ultimate Kit for Beginners), 센서 키트 ‘아두이노만 제외’

   



- 센서키트


- The X-NUCLEO-IKS01A1 SPI, I2C 실습용

 ·LSM6DS0: MEMS 3D accelerometer (±2/±4/±8 g) + 3D gyroscope (±245/±500/±2000 dps)

 ·LIS3MDL: MEMS 3D magnetometer (±4/ ±8/ ±12/ 16 gauss)

 ·LPS25HB*: MEMS pressure sensor, 260-1260 hPa absolute digital output barometer

 ·HTS221: capacitive digital relative humidity and temperature

 ·DIL 24-pin socket available for additional MEMS adapters and other sensors (UV index)

 ·Free comprehensive development firmware library and example for all sensors compatible with STM32Cube firmware

 ·Compatible with STM32 Nucleo boards

 ·Equipped with Arduino UNO R3 connector

 ·RoHS compliant



  □ 교육 시간 및 교육 인원

   - 교육 시간 : 35시간

   - 컴파일러 : Arm 기본 컴파일러(무료 사용)

   - 교육 인원 : 최대 20명


일차

세부내용

주강사/보조강사

1

- ARM Processor

- 오픈 소스로 펌웨어 만드는 방법

- Mbed는 무엇인가요?

- Mbed로 장치 다루기 (1)

주강사: 한기태

보조강사: 장병남

2

- Mbed로 장치 다루기 (2)

주강사: 한기태

보조강사: 장병남

3

- RTOS (임베디드 시스템을 위한)

- Mbed-OS는 무엇인가요?

- Mbed-OS EventQueue

- Mbed-OS 설정 위한 시스템 분석

주강사: 한기태

보조강사: 장병남

4

- 와이파이 모듈 소개 및 실습 - WizFi310

- Mbed Cloud 소개 및 연동테스트

주강사: 한기태

보조강사: 장병남

5

- 웹에 어떻게 띄울 것인가?

- Mbed Cloud - Thing+ 연동

- postman + 달리웍스

- django로 웹서비스 만들기

- heroku 배포

주강사: 한기태

보조강사: 김동철


다. 모집 개요

  □ 모집대상 

    - 서울시 소재, 사물인터넷 분야에 재직 중이거나, 아래의 기준 중 하나 이상 충족하는 기업 개발자

      ① 서울IoT워크숍관련 하드웨어 개발자 및 SI 프로젝트 개발 실무자

      ② 전자기기에서 사용하는 하드웨어/소프트웨어 관련 개발자 

      ③ C언어 가능하며, IoT 디바이스를 를 국내외에 출시할 계획이 있는 기업의 개발자

       ※ 예비창업기업의 개발자 가능

  □ 모집규모 : 최대 20명/1회

  □ 참가비용 : 무료

  □ 신청방법 : 서울산업진흥원 홈페이지를 통한 신청서 접수

  □ 참가자 선정 

    - 개발 계획의 구체성/시기(50%), 개발 역량 (50%)

    - 심사방법 : 서면평가 

    ※ 예비후보 3인 선정후 중도포기자 발생시 충원 

  □ 주요 일정   ※ 변동 가능

    - 신청/접수 : ‘18.9.17(월) ~ 10. 1(월)  

    - 선정심사 : 10.2(화)

    - 선정발표 : 10.3(수)


라. 신청방법 

  □ 서울진흥원 웹사이트에서 신청 (www.sba.kr)

    application_arm_mbed.hwp

행사안내 : http://gvalley.seoul.kr


 
90, Digital-ro 9-gil, Geumcheon-gu, Seoul, Republic of Korea
https://seouliotworkshop.tistory.com/   
mail: 12000@12000.co
Copyright 2021 by Seoul Businsss Agency. All Rights Reserved. (Powered by Tistory)
workshop | Recent Articles +more
  •  
  •  
  •  
  •  
  •  
  •  
  •  
workshop | News +more
  •  
  •  
  •  
  •  
  •  
  •  
  •  
workshop | Schedule +more
  •  
  •  
  •  
  •  
  •  
  •  
  •  
workshop | Workshops    more
workshop | Toolkit    more
workshop | Video Tutorial    more
workshop | Events +more
  •  
  •  
  •  
  •  
  •  
  •  
  •  
workshop | Others +more
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Previous Hackathon    more

programs run by :

90, Digital-ro 9-gil, Geumcheon-gu, Seoul, Republic of Korea https://seouliotworkshop.tistory.com/
mail: 12000@12000.co